A Professional Certificate in Refugee Youth Trauma Support equips participants with the essential skills and knowledge to effectively support young refugees grappling with the psychological impact of displacement and trauma. This specialized training program focuses on culturally sensitive approaches and best practices in trauma-informed care.
Learning outcomes for this certificate program include mastering trauma-informed interviewing techniques, understanding the unique challenges faced by refugee youth, and developing tailored intervention strategies. Participants will also gain proficiency in crisis intervention and resource navigation, crucial for effective support provision. The curriculum incorporates practical applications and case studies to enhance learning and skill development within a mental health context.
The duration of the Professional Certificate in Refugee Youth Trauma Support typically ranges from several weeks to a few months, depending on the intensity and format of the program. Many programs offer flexible online learning options alongside in-person workshops or practicums, catering to diverse schedules and learning preferences. The program includes a robust curriculum focusing on child psychology and adolescent development.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ance for professionals working with refugee populations, including social workers, counselors, educators, and healthcare providers. The skills gained are directly applicable to various settings, such as schools, community centers, non-profit organizations, and mental health clinics. Graduates will be prepared to contribute meaningfully to the well-being of vulnerable youth within humanitarian settings and NGOs.
Moreover, this Professional Certificate in Refugee Youth Trauma Support enhances career prospects for those seeking specialization in trauma-informed care and refugee mental health.
